Output 15911cdede3500d28812201df24cf0879aaeb8520d71c8fece0e5b0ea6ad67cc:0

value
13262
script pubkey
OP_0 OP_PUSHBYTES_20 f688857ecb833b78ec3daed93bd2bd8d9031337c
address
bc1q76yg2lktsvah3mpa4mvnh54a3kgrzvmuapnvkj
transaction
15911cdede3500d28812201df24cf0879aaeb8520d71c8fece0e5b0ea6ad67cc
confirmations
686
spent
false